Text
(A)For purposes of this section, "competency-based educational program" and "eligible individual" have the same meanings as in section3317.23of the Revised Code.
(B)An eligible individual may enroll in a joint vocational school district that operates an adult education program for up to two cumulative school years for the purpose of completing the requirements to earn a high school diploma. An individual enrolled under this division may elect to satisfy these requirements by successfully completing a competency-based educational program that complies with the standards adopted by the department of education and workforce under section3317.231of the Revised Code.
